A public war of words is a heated, often hostile exchange of arguments or insults conducted through media channels like social media or press releases. It is used to shape public opinion, damage an opponent’s credibility, or rally supporters. Politicians, celebrities, and corporate leaders benefit by gaining visibility, controlling narratives, or distracting from controversies.
